恩..這邊主要是自己的筆記
自己最近想弄一些作品
MVC是已經會的東西
於是想自學一下Angular
遇到需要mat-table的東西 光環境就搞了很久 筆記一下
1.直接開啟建立2019的Angular範例
2.於ClientApp開啟終端機
3.Set-ExecutionPolicy (如果不做這行 下一行可能會掛掉 可以先做4 不行再回頭來做這個
4.ng add @angular/material (安裝angular/material 一路Y到底
5.在app.module.ts import這四個
import { MatTableModule } from '@angular/material/table';
import { MatTabsModule } from '@angular/material/tabs';
import { MatSortModule } from '@angular/material/sort';
import { BrowserAnimationsModule } from '@angular/platform-browser/animations';
6.剩下照https://material.angular.io/components/table/overview
裡面的sort做
7.記得將@ViewChild(MatSort) sort: MatSort;
修改為@ViewChild(MatSort, { static: true }) sort: MatSort;
這樣做出來的mattable就可以sort了
以上 筆記!